Product Overview: The document is a data sheet for a Neurotensin antibody, catalog number RA20072, produced by Neuromics. The antibody is derived from rabbit whole serum and is reactive with mouse and rat species. It is intended for research use only, specifically for in vitro and certain non-human in vivo experimental applications.
Specifications: The immunogen sequence is a synthetic peptide (human) Neurotensin coupled to bovine thyroglobulin using glutaraldehyde. The product is lyophilized and contains less than 0.09% sodium azide as a preservative.
Applications and Usage: The antibody is suitable for immunohistochemistry applications. Recommended dilutions are 1:200-1:400 for indirect immunofluorescence and 1:4,000-1:8,000 for the biotin/avidin-HRP technique. Optimal dilutions should be determined by the investigator.
Reconstitution and Storage: The product should not be reconstituted until ready to use. It is most stable when lyophilized and should be stored at -15º C or lower for long-term storage. Once reconstituted with 100 μL of distilled or deionized water, it should be stored at +2-8º C for up to 3 months or at -20º C for longer periods. Avoid repeated freeze-thaw cycles.
Tissue Preparation: For tissue preparation, a 10 μm cryostat section is recommended. Fixative used is 4% paraformaldehyde in 0.1 M phosphate buffer, pH 7.4, with post-fixation for 1.5 hours at 4°C. Incubation should be done for 18-24 hours at 2-8° C.
Quality Control: The Neurotensin antiserum has been quality control tested using standard immunohistochemical methods, showing significant labeling of rat amygdala.

Neurotensin Data Sheet Host: Rabbit Species M°use, Rat Reactivity: Format: Lyophilized. 100 ul with <0.09% sodium azide as a preservative. Product Type: Whole Seinm Immunogen Sequence: Synthetic peptide (human) Neurotensin coupled to bovine thyroglobulin (BTg) with glutaraldehyde. Applications: lmmunohistochemistry: 1:200-1:400 (in PBS/0.3% Triton X-100 - Indirect Immunofluorescence). 1:4,000-1:8,000 (in in PBS/0.3% Triton X-100 - Bn/Av-HRP Technique). Dilutions listed as a recommendation. Optimal dilution should be determined by investigator. Reconstitution: Do not reconstitute until ready to use since the product is most stable when lyophilized. The product does not need to be cooled during shipping. For long-term storage, store lyophilized antibody until ready to use at -15° C or lower. Reconstitute with 100 pL of distilled or deionized water. Storage: Maintain at +2-8°C for 3 months or at -20°C for longer periods. Stable for 1 year. Avoid repeated freeze-thaw cycles. Tissue Preparation: 10 pm cryostat •Fixative: 4% paraformaldehyde in 0.1 M phosphate buffer, pH 7.4; 500 mL over ~20-30 min. •Post Fixation: 1.5 hr. at 4°C in 4% paraformaldehyde in 0.1 M phosphate buffer, pH 7.4. •Incubation: 18-24 hours at 2-8° C. Immunohistochemistry: Our Neurotensin antiserum was quality control tested using standard immunohistochemical methods. The antiserum demonstrates significant labeling of rat amygdala using indirect immunofluorescent and biotin/avidin-HRP techniques.
